  • Publication number: 20240029935
    Abstract: A storage choke assembly for a multi-phase DC-to-DC converter for converting a DC input voltage to a DC charging voltage for charging a vehicle battery in an electric vehicle, fuel cell vehicle, or hybrid vehicle, includes a storage choke that has one or more coils, and a housing in which the storage choke is accommodated, wherein the housing has a first housing section and a second housing section, wherein the first housing section is made of a first thermosetting plastic and is in direct contact with one or more coils, wherein the second housing section is made of a second thermosetting plastic, wherein the first thermosetting plastic has a higher thermal conductivity than the second thermosetting plastic.

  • Patent number: 11457321
    Abstract: A hearing aid device having a telecoil and a power consuming element is disclosed. The hearing aid device further comprises an at least partial loop in the power supply line, which at least partial loop provides a magnetic signal that at least attenuates or cancels noise induced from the power draw of the power consuming component.

  • Publication number: 20190126525
    Abstract: An injection molding tool is provided, comprising a base carrier that is suitable to accommodate an insert component, wherein at least one separate part of the base carrier forms a contact surface with the insert component after it has been inserted into the base carrier, wherein at least the contact surface features a high-temperature material. Furthermore, a method for the sealing of insert components is provided.

  • Publication number: 20090093010
    Abstract: Methods and kits for monitoring kidney function, and detecting kidney dysfunction and transplant related disease and rejection are disclosed. The method involves analyzing a sample, such as a urine sample, containing protein from an animal for fragments of ?2-microglobulin, wherein the presence of specific ?2-microglobulin fragments is indicative of kidney dysfunction and transplant rejection. In another embodiement, urine samples from an animal are tested for protease activity, such as cathepsin D or napsin A, wherein increased protease activity compared to a control sample is indicative of kidney dysfunction.
